Hello and Welcome

I'm Renia, the content creator, and curator behind the Houston-based blog Black Allergy Mama. I started this blog to highlight my life as a professional foodie, but in 2018, following the birth of my daughter Emory, the vision for my blog shifted. At nine months old, Emory was diagnosed with various food allergies. Then, I decided to use this space to highlight delicious allergy-friendly recipes, products, resources, and a glimpse into my life as a Black allergy mom! This Spring, I successfully obtained my Advanced Food Allergies and Intolerances certification. Further strengthening my ability to provide research-based advice to help you and your family navigate food allergies.
